All warnings (new ones prefixed by >>):

   drivers/mtd/spi-nor/cadence-quadspi.c: In function 'cqspi_probe':
>> drivers/mtd/spi-nor/cadence-quadspi.c:1230:10: warning: cast from pointer to 
>> integer of different size [-Wpointer-to-int-cast]
     data  = (u32)of_device_get_match_data(&pdev->dev);
             ^
